Google Site Index - sitemap.xml 示例

用于Google网站索引,通过自动化工作流程定期获取并更新sitemap.xml中的URL,确保搜索引擎及时获取最新内容,提升网站在搜索结果中的可见性和排名。该流程包含21个节点,自动检查URL状态,处理新更新的内容,节省人工操作时间,提高效率。

2025/7/8
21 个节点
复杂
计划复杂splitoutsplitinbatcheswait计划触发器便签自动化高级api集成cron逻辑条件数据解析
分类:
Schedule TriggeredComplex Workflow
集成服务:
SplitOutSplitInBatchesWaitSchedule TriggerSticky Note

适用人群

该工作流适合以下人群:
- 网站管理员:希望自动化网站的索引更新,确保搜索引擎能够及时抓取最新内容。
- SEO专家:需要监控和更新网站的索引状态,以提高搜索引擎排名。
- 开发人员:想要通过API与Google索引服务集成,自动化处理URL更新。
- 内容创作者:希望确保其最新发布的内容能够被搜索引擎快速识别和索引。

解决的问题

该工作流解决了以下问题:
- 自动化URL更新:通过与Google的索引API集成,自动提交更新的URL,节省手动提交的时间。
- 监控索引状态:实时检查URL的索引状态,确保所有重要页面都已被索引。
- 处理多个内容类型:支持处理多个类型的sitemap,确保所有页面都被覆盖并及时更新。

工作流程

工作流过程详解:
1. 定时触发:通过调度触发器,定期获取sitemap.xml。
2. 获取sitemap:向指定的URL请求sitemap.xml文件,解析出所有包含的URL。
3. 提取内容特定sitemaps:从sitemap中提取内容特定的sitemap链接。
4. 转换为JSON格式:将sitemap XML数据转换为JSON格式以便后续处理。
5. 循环处理每个URL:对每个URL进行循环处理,检查其索引状态。
6. 检查状态:使用HTTP请求检查每个URL的索引状态,如果有更新则进行处理。
7. 等待随机时间:在处理请求之间等待随机时间,以避免触发API的速率限制。
8. 更新URL:如果URL是新的或有更新,则通过API提交URL更新请求。

自定义指南

用户如何自定义和调整该工作流:
- 调整调度时间:根据需求修改调度触发器的时间设置,以适应特定的更新频率。
- 修改sitemap URL:在获取sitemap的HTTP请求中,替换为实际的网站sitemap URL。
- 添加条件判断:可以在检查状态的节点中添加更多条件,以处理特定的URL更新逻辑。
- 自定义API请求:根据需要修改API请求的参数和处理逻辑,以适应不同的API使用场景。